My lights only stay on for a minute or to then flicker off I know that is a common problem with the headlights switch but what about the dash lights they don't work at all I checked all bulbs and the circuit board on the back of cluster and used a 9 volt battery where the connecter goes and it lit up fine so I am not getting power from the switch or I have a bad ground which terminal is what and where can I connect the 9volt batt to the switch plug to test the wires going to the cluster and can all of it just be switch related. Please help.

 
Quick thought...kick/wiggle your bright beam dimmer foot switch. That son of gun wreaked havoc on me for a few months before I figured it out.

Believe me, it was the last thing I though of. Replaced it at Autozone for $10. They even had one in stock.

 
Well, the dimmer switch is not related to the dash lamps. It's possible that your fuse is blown, or that your headlight switch rheostat is bad, or...the knob is not rotated to the proper direction.

You can measure the voltage on both sides of the smallest fuse on the fuse block while your headlight knob is pulled out. One side is from the headlight switch; the other side are all of your dash lamps.
